I have a large csv file which looks like this:
"Ion N","Mass","Charge","X","Y","Z","Azm","Elv","KE"
3849094,0.00054858,-1,66.5216,-51,-3.8,-180,88.7,18160
3849095,0.00054858,-1,27.3925,30.3532,-4.07076,-177.1,41.5494,17697.2
3849096,0.00054858,-1,66.5216,-51,-3.7,-180,88.7,18160
3849097,0.00054858,-1,26.6277,31.0039,-3.91402,-177.096,40.8293,17699.4
3849098,0.00054858,-1,66.5216,-51,-3.6,-180,88.7,18160
3849099,0.00054858,-1,4.125,44.9887,-2.47517,-176.363,25.715,17711.1
To create and array with each second row I use the following command:
data(2:2:end,:) = []
My output file then looks like this:
"Ion N","Mass","Charge","X","Y","Z","Azm","Elv","KE"
3849095,0.00054858,-1,27.3925,30.3532,-4.07076,-177.1,41.5494,17697.2
3849097,0.00054858,-1,26.6277,31.0039,-3.91402,-177.096,40.8293,17699.4
3849099,0.00054858,-1,4.125,44.9887,-2.47517,-176.363,25.715,17711.1
However, I wish to keep the first row and delete the second one and keep the third row and so on but the following command doesn't seem to work.
data(1:1:end, :) = []
My desired output file should look like this:
"Ion N","Mass","Charge","X","Y","Z","Azm","Elv","KE"
3849094,0.00054858,-1,66.5216,-51,-3.8,-180,88.7,18160
3849096,0.00054858,-1,66.5216,-51,-3.7,-180,88.7,18160
3849098,0.00054858,-1,66.5216,-51,-3.6,-180,88.7,18160
Could anyone advise on how I can implement this?

I'm not following your examples but does this solve your problem?
data(1:2:end, :) = []
or
data(2:2:end, :) = []
